HubSpot (NYSE:HUBSG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, August 5th. The software maker reported $3.26 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$3.02 by $0.24. HubSpot had a return on equity of 8.66% and a net margin of 4.26%.The company had revenue of $911.74 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$898.31 million. During the same period last year, the business earned $2.19 earnings per share. The business’s revenue was up 19.8% on a year-over-year basis. HubSpot has set its FY 2026 guidance at 13.230-13.310 EPS and its Q3 2026 guidance at 3.250-3.270 EPS. Research analysts expect that HubSpot will post 4.54 EPS for the current fiscal year.

HubSpot, Inc is a software company that develops a cloud-based customer relationship management (CRM) platform designed to help organizations attract, engage and delight customers. Its primary business activities center on providing integrated marketing, sales and customer service tools that support inbound marketing strategies, content management, lead nurturing, sales automation and customer support workflows.

The company’s product suite is organized around modular “hubs” built on a central CRM: Marketing Hub, Sales Hub, Service Hub, CMS Hub and Operations Hub.
